What kind of loan from the SBA is best for a small business in Miami?

The best loan from the SBA for a Miami small business depends on its specific needs, such as startup costs, real estate purchase, or working capital. The SBA 7(a) loan is the most common and versatile, suitable for many purposes. The SBA 504 loan is ideal for purchasing fixed assets like buildings or equipment. What's the difference between a personal loan and an SBA loan for a Miami entrepreneur?

A personal loan is based on an individual's creditworthiness, while an SBA loan is for business purposes and is partially guaranteed by the Small Business Administration. SBA loans often offer larger amounts, longer repayment terms, and potentially lower interest rates compared to personal loans for business use.
